Bromine in PDB 5m8u: Pce Reductive Dehalogenase From S. Multivorans in Complex with 4- Bromophenol

Protein crystallography data

The structure of Pce Reductive Dehalogenase From S. Multivorans in Complex with 4- Bromophenol, PDB code: 5m8u was solved by C.Kunze, M.Bommer, W.R.Hagen, M.Uksa, H.Dobbek, T.Schubert, G.Diekert,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 36.77 / 1.90
Space group P 41
Cell size a, b, c (Å), α, β, γ (°) 73.547, 73.547, 184.517, 90.00, 90.00, 90.00
R / Rfree (%) 14.6 / 17.2

Other elements in 5m8u:

The structure of Pce Reductive Dehalogenase From S. Multivorans in Complex with 4- Bromophenol also contains other interesting chemical elements:

Cobalt (Co) 2 atoms
Iron (Fe) 16 atoms
